    As I have said, work has been really stressful at the moment. There are so many reasons why:

    1. January and the beginning of the year is always a very busy time as people come back from Christmas and realise they need to re-finance because they want more money for next year and people do move as well.

    2. The financial situation in the UK is not that great because of the problems with Northern Rock. In case you hadn't heard, they basically went bankrupt which means that the customers who save with them have lost out on their money. That has also had a bad effect on the general financial markets and does effect mortgages to some extent as well. This is not helped by the crisis with housing in the US and also the fact that teh stocks and shares had a bad day on Monday with losing £80 billion. That makes selling mortgages much harder because people are more worried about changing things.

    The game we got this year was Thurn and Taxis which is based on the original mail routes in the middle of Europe. You are trying to build up post routes through Germany (and surrounding areas) by connecting towns. There are various points for long routes and also having a prescence in all towns within a state/county/area of the country.
